Resumen:
Total mineralization of the nonionic surfactant nonylphenol ethoxylate is rarely observed due to the persistence of degradation intermediates under most environmental conditions. The object of this work was to elucidate the role of alternate electron acceptor on the biodegradation of NPEO. We applied 1H-NMR and GC-MS in order to characterize the formation of most significant metabolites by mixed microbial mixtures growing on NPEO under aerobic, fermentative, sufidogenic, or denitrifying conditions. The formation of nonylphenol coupled to nitrate reduction implies that the denitrifying consortium possesses an alternate pathway for the degradation of NPEO, which is not accessible under aerobic conditions.
